SUMMARY
The mouse cursor gets offset for one frame or so when it transitions to a
different icon, such as hovering over a clickable link or at the edge of a
window.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Open a terminal (Or any preferred window), make sure it is not maximized.
2. Place the cursor at the bottom of the window, causing the icon for adjusting
the height of the window to pop up.
3. Move the mouse rapidly between this position and a few pixels down, causing
the icon to change rapidly. Note that moving the cursor rapidly, or this
specific icon transition is not necessary for reproducing the bug but it is the
way it becomes the most visible.

OBSERVED RESULT
The icon sometimes gets displaced to the lower right for about a frame causing
a form of flickering.

EXPECTED RESULT
The icon should switch without jumping around.
